Gusset ALP 3030
The 3030 bracket/Gusset is an external fastening method that creates a 90 degree connection. 3030 means this size is used for 30 series aluminum profile with a quick connection by bolt and nut.

Gusset Alp 3030: The Small Part That Solves Big Problems

Let's get technical for a second—don't worry, I'll keep it simple. A gusset is a support piece, usually triangular, that reinforces the joint where two parts meet. In machine frames, gussets prevent joints from bending or twisting under load, which is crucial for stability. Traditional gussets are often made of steel (heavy, hard to adjust) or plastic (weak, not durable). Gusset Alp 3030, though, is designed specifically for 3030 aluminum profiles —those sleek, T-slotted aluminum beams that have become a favorite in modern manufacturing for their lightweight strength and modularity.

What makes Gusset Alp 3030 stand out? Start with the material: high-grade aluminum alloy. It's strong enough to handle the rigors of a busy shop floor—think vibrations from machinery, heavy tool storage, or the constant movement of parts—yet light enough that even a single worker can carry a handful of them. Unlike steel, it won't rust, which is a huge plus in environments where moisture or chemicals are present. And because it's aluminum, it's easy to drill, cut, or modify if needed (though with its smart design, you rarely will).

Then there's the fit. Gusset Alp 3030 is engineered to snap seamlessly into the T-slots of 3030 aluminum profiles. No drilling holes, no welding, no messy adhesives. Aluminum Profiles and Gusset Alp 3030: A Match Made in the Shop

To really appreciate Gusset Alp 3030, you need to understand its partner in crime: the 3030 aluminum profile. These profiles are the building blocks of modular manufacturing. Imagine giant, industrial-grade Erector Set pieces—hollow aluminum beams with slots running along their length, perfect for attaching brackets, shelves, casters, or just about anything else. They're lightweight (about a third the weight of steel for the same strength), corrosion-resistant, and infinitely customizable. But even the best building blocks need strong connections, which is where our gusset comes in.

Think of 3030 profiles as the bones of your machine frame, and Gusset Alp 3030 as the ligaments holding them together. Without ligaments, bones can't support weight or movement; without gussets, aluminum profiles (while strong) can flex at the joints under heavy loads. This isn't just about safety—though that's critical. It's about precision. In manufacturing, even a tiny amount of flex in a frame can throw off measurements, leading to defective products or misaligned machinery. Gusset Alp 3030 eliminates that flex by distributing weight evenly across the joint, ensuring your frame stays stable no matter what you throw at it.

Even small details matter, like 3030 aluminum profile end caps . These simple plastic or aluminum caps slide over the ends of 3030 profiles, covering sharp edges and preventing dust or debris from getting inside. When paired with Gusset Alp 3030, they turn a functional frame into a polished, professional setup. One common pushback I hear is, "Aluminum isn't as strong as steel—won't it bend or break?" It's a fair question. While it's true that steel has a higher tensile strength, aluminum's strength-to-weight ratio is superior. That means for the same weight, aluminum can handle just as much load—and often more, because it's lighter and easier to reinforce with accessories like Gusset Alp 3030. Plus, aluminum doesn't fatigue like steel. Over time, steel frames can develop stress cracks from vibrations; aluminum, with its flexibility, absorbs those vibrations better, leading to longer lifespans.

Then there's maintenance. Steel frames need regular painting or coating to prevent rust, especially in humid or industrial environments. Aluminum? Wipe it down with a damp cloth, and it looks like new. Gusset Alp 3030, made from the same aluminum alloy, resists corrosion and wear, so you won't be replacing it every few years.
